Informational event for online MBA set for Feb. 17

Prospective students interested in learning more about Bemidji State University’s new online master of business administration program are invited to join program faculty and administrators for a free information session, Feb. 17.

MBABemidji_100The session will begin at 7 p.m. in the Gathering Room at BSU’s American Indian Resource Center. Faculty teaching in the new program will be on hand to answer questions about the BSU MBA’s curriculum, areas of specialization, the admissions process, tuition and available financial aid.

Students interested in starting the MBA program in the fall of 2014 must enroll by May 1.

BSU’s online MBA program will provide students with advanced-level skills and understanding needed to succeed in today’s rapidly changing business world. It is designed to be completed in two years with specialization in management, marketing or finance. It is designed for both working professionals and people who have just completed their bachelor’s degrees.

Program structure
Bemidji State’s MBA program will include 36 semester credits, with 30 core credits in 10 required courses and a two-course, six-credit elective concentration area.
